Re: And in the end


And in the end


> But for the most part the environment seems much closer to isolationism than united nations.


It’s a fair point! If Gemini was a forum, most of the threads would have just one post.


I’ve appreciated your posts pulling together and commenting on recent posts from across Geminispace. Thank you! It makes the whole quite a bit more interactive ... even if usually what we end up with is “threads” of two posts.


I’m not sure if this is something to be improved, or working as intended. I already wrote that I’d appreciate a convenient way to say “thanks” as I read someone’s Gemlog; and that I’d use “s/discuss” on Bubble to more conveniently reply to posts. Of course I can also post replies here. But I think there is something about long form content plus a slight barrier to posting that means I’ll only reply if I have something substantial to say.


Part of getting used to Gemini has been learning to do things more slowly. I’m now reading mostly via my “yesterday” meta-aggregator, so I don’t usually read posts the day they’re posted but the next day. Even that feels like maybe too fast, on further reflection.


I believe—I’ve read about it in books—there was a time when you’d send a personal letter then wait weeks for a reply. It’s somewhat hard to wrap my head around. I’m so used to discussions being resolved in minutes, hours, days at the most. Perhaps a 10x or more change in expectations is in order.


At work I decided about a month ago to mostly stop using “chat”—synchronous online communication with my colleagues—in favour of email. That seems to have been a positive change overall, although I find I now need to put more effort into casual, not-quite-work-related, email with my colleagues in order to stay socially connected. Work in progress.


Maybe a similar pattern applies here: slow communication with a bit of extra emphasis on staying sufficiently connected. Maybe I should join in with some “recent posts across Geminispace” posts.
